Kip Evans

Kip has a extensive history of excellence in photography and filmmaking. As a certified drone pilot he has captured aerial content in many countries around the world, including Mexico, Costa Rica, Spain, Africa, and the Galapagos with a perfect safety record. He has flown missions for the US Golf Association to create aerial content for several promotional videos including for use during U.S. Opens. He has also worked with central California growers to document vineyards, lettuce fields, and other crops. 

As a filmmaker and photographer, Kip has led or participated in more than seventy expeditions throughout the world. As a photographer, he has worked on dozens of National Geographic Society projects since 1998, including the five-year Sustainable Seas project to explore and document the U.S. National Marine Sanctuaries. As a cinematographer, Kip’s films have been featured at film festivals around the world and he has contributed video work to all the major television networks including National Geographic, BBC and Discovery. From 2008-2020 he was the directory of photography and expeditions for Mission Blue.
